What Is Employment Identity Theft?

What Is Employment Identity Theft?

Employment identity theft happens when someone uses your Social Security number or other personal identifying information for employment purposes. Identity thieves may use your identity to get a job they aren’t qualified for or collect wages using your Social Security number.
